Sandhala Population - Yamunanagar, Haryana

Sandhala is a medium size village located in Jagadhri Tehsil of Yamunanagar district, Haryana with total 250 families residing. The Sandhala village has population of 1397 of which 730 are males while 667 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Sandhala village population of children with age 0-6 is 141 which makes up 10.09 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Sandhala village is 914 which is higher than Haryana state average of 879. Child Sex Ratio for the Sandhala as per census is 785, lower than Haryana average of 834.

Sandhala village has higher literacy rate compared to Haryana. In 2011, literacy rate of Sandhala village was 79.22 % compared to 75.55 % of Haryana. In Sandhala Male literacy stands at 85.87 % while female literacy rate was 72.07 %.

Caste Factor

Sandhala village of Yamunanagar has substantial population of Schedule Caste.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 31.57 % of total population in Sandhala village. The village Sandhala curr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Sandhala village out of total population, 426 were engaged in work activities. 96.95 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 3.05 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 426 workers engaged in Main Work, 132 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 189 were Agricultural labourer.
